Today I have an EASY PEASY project for you that would be PERFECT for school parties or extra little treats for your kids and their friends besides candy. They'll get enough of that, won't they?

This Trick Tac Toe uses bottle caps as pieces and a simple piece of card stock for a board (laminating the board wouldn't be a bad idea). For the pieces, I stamped and colored the candy from Treats for my Sweet, and stamped the web (green) and spider (black) from the same set onto white card stock. After punch them out with my 1" Circle Punch, I adhered them to the inside of the bottle caps with pop dots. They were then glittered with Star Dust Stickles. Pieces: done.

I created the board in Photoshop and printed it out. I then stamped the bats and kitty from Treats for my Sweet to add some spookiness.
